The special Wales present Tottenham defender Joe Rodon delivered and the text exchange which said it all

Joe Rodon produced an heroic display as Wales booked their place in the knockout rounds of Euro 2020 with a battling display against Italy.

Rob Page's men withstood waves of Italian pressure and also had Ethan Ampadu sent off in the second half at Stadio Olimpico.

But - despite losing 1-0 - they clinched runner-up spot in Group A due to their superior goal difference over Switzerland who defeated Turkey 3-1 in Baku.

Tottenham Hotspur man Rodon - who also excelled in the 2-0 win over Turkey - was central to Wales' monumental defensive effort against the Azzurri.

He topped the Wales charts in each of the following categories: Clearances (6), blocked shots (2) and aerials won (4).

The central defender was also one of only two players (Daniel James being the other) to play a key pass while he had his side's only effort on target in Rome.

To put it simply, the former Swansea City man was nothing short of a colossus.

And his performance ensured he not only played a starring role in getting Wales into the last 16, but it also meant he delivered the perfect Father's Day present.

On the morning of the crunch fixture in the Italian capital, the defender asked his dad Keri Rodon what present he wanted for the occasion.

Rodon Sr responded: "A man of the match performance, please!"

The Wales and Spurs ace simply replied: "I'll do my best."

And the Rodon family were left overjoyed as the 23-year-old shone in the ferocious Stadio Olimpico heat to ensure his and Wales' run in the tournament was extended.

Page's side will take on one of Belgium, Russia, Finland or Denmark in the last 16 on Saturday.

The game will take place at Amsterdam's Johan Cruyff Arena. Kick-off is at 5pm.

The winner of that contest will book their place in the quarter-final at Baku's Olympic Stadium on Saturday, July 3.

Both Euro 2020 semi-finals and the final will be held at Wembley.
